Another reason for the absence: I was in pain for the past three weeks I think. A bad case of sinusitis, so bad it triggered another severe tooth ache, which led to it’s extraction. It happened before, summer before I entered 3rd year high school. My tooth ached so bad, it was like my head is being split in two, the dentist doesn’t want to extract the tooth because it was a good tooth, no cavities, no decay, even the x-ray did not reveal anything unusual, but it was really painful. After a couple of days, before I figured out what was going on, the pain suddenly stopped, so I did not pursue it anymore. Years after, I found out that a bad sinusitis can feel like your tooth or even the whole upper set of teeth is aching.

Today I visited the EENT clinic, the doctor said I have to treat the cause of my sinusitis, which is allergic rhinitis, he prescribed tons of medicine, good thing Amy is weaned already. He said that allergy is with me for life, I just have to control it to avoid complications like sinusitis and asthma. He said some people even develops polyps inside the nasal passage. He said I have none (I had a nasal endoscopy).
